## Configuration — Gatecount

Gatecount tallies turnstile pulses at Ravelin Stadium and pushes totals to the ops dashboard every 10 seconds. Set GATECOUNT_VENUE_ID and GATECOUNT_FLUSH_INTERVAL in the env file; defaults suit most events. The dashboard API requires an auth credential, which must be the next line in the file.

env line for fafof-fahag: LEDGER_TOKEN5=f8790

Subject: Gross-Margin Review — Action Required

Team,

Q2 margins slipped 2.1 points group-wide. Worst hit: the Brindlemoor branch (freight) and the Tessock line (discounting). Effective immediately: no discounts above 12% without regional sign-off; freight surcharges pass through on orders under the threshold; weekly margin reports due Fridays. Velstra product family is exempt pending relaunch. Branch managers present recovery plans at the month-end call. No exceptions. The reasoning behind these moves is summarised in the note below.

board note of yadup-fajef: Druiusox Holdings is in early talks to buy Norwynek Systems for about $186.0 million. The Kaseth launch date is June 24, and nothing goes to the press before then. Legal wants the Quenethek Group term sheet withdrawn before November 27.

## Add rotation backoff to keymill

This PR teaches the keymill rotation utility to stagger secret rotations instead of rotating everything at once. Staggering avoids thundering-herd reauth storms against the vault backend, which caused last month's slowdown. Please read `rotation.md` before reviewing — the state machine there explains when a rotation is considered committed versus pending. The schedule is driven by the constants below, which were validated in staging:

tuning constants:
BUDGETS = {
    "druath": 240,
    "lamwyn": 180,
    "silael": 275,
}

Subject: Handover — Meridock release duty

Hi Tovar,

Quick handover note. The flaky DNS resolution on the Quillspan staging cluster is still open; resolution intermittently fails for the artifact registry, so retries are enabled in the deploy script. If a push stalls, rerun it rather than restarting the resolver. Everything else is green. You'll need the deploy key below to push hotfixes.

rollout seal: bky4_x7Gc